Whilst the official synopsis remains under wraps, the original arc’s synopsis is all we have to go on for an indication of the plot:

Days of Future Past is a classic storyline that unfolded in two issues of Marvel Comics’ Uncanny X-Men in 1981, from writer Chris Claremont and artists John Byrne and Terry Austin. The story was partially set in an alternate future where surviving mutants have been penned in concentration camps, giant robots called Sentinels patrol America, and most of the X-Men have been hunted and killed. In the present day, the X-Men were forced to stop a key event from unfolding in order to keep that future from occurring.

James McAvoy, Michael Fassbender, Hugh Jackman, Patrick Stewart, Ian McKellen, Jennifer Lawrence, Nicholas Hoult, Anna Paquin, Shawn Ashmore, Ellen Page, Peter Dinklage, Omar Sy, Halle Berry lead what is undeniably the best cast of the franchise so far.

Singer returns to the helm, directing from a script penned by Simon Kinberg, Matthew Vaughn, and Jane Goldman.

X-Men: Days of Future Past will be released in 3D on 22nd May, 2014 here in the UK, with its US release date set for the next day on May 23rd.
